tally_mono_vector: Vector Tally of Mono-syllabic Words

Description

Mono-syllabic word tallies for the words in a vector of strings.

Usage

tally_mono_vector(x, ...)

Arguments

x
A character vector.
...
ignored.

Value

Returns a vector of integer tallies for the total number of monosyllable words for each string in the vector.

Examples

Run this code
sents <- c("I like chicken.", "I want eggs Benedict for breakfast.")
tally_mono_vector(sents)
tally_mono_vector(presidential_debates_2012$dialogue)
